%I A118030
%S A118030 1,2,4,8,12,16,20,28,36,44,52,64,76,88,100,116,132,148,164,184,204,224,
               244,264,284,304,324,352,380,408,436,
%T A118030 464,492,520,548,584,620,656,692,728,764,800,836,880,924,968,1012,1056,
%U A118030 1100,1144,1188,1240,1292,1344,1396,1448,1500,1552,1604,1656,1708,1760
%N A118030 a(1)=1. a(n) = a(n-1) + (largest integer which is <= n and occurs among 
               the earlier terms of the sequence).
